Kakadu National Park offers visitors an opportunity to observe diverse wildlife, explore its numerous rivers, and engage with Aboriginal cultural heritage at the Warradjan Cultural Centre.



Embark on a captivating journey through the breathtaking landscapes of Kakadu National Park, offering visitors a unique opportunity to explore its diverse ecosystems. Start your exploration along the picturesque mangrove-fringed coastlines, seamlessly blending into expansive floodplains. Marvel at the juxtaposition of lowland hills, encircled by eastern sandstone escarpments, amidst a tapestry of various open woodlands and forests.

Witness the rich cultural heritage of the Aboriginal people as you visit the Warradjan Cultural Centre, where informative displays vividly depict their traditional ways of life. Your itinerary concludes with an optional 50-minute scenic flight, providing a distinct vantage point over this dynamic landscape.

Undertake a thrilling excursion aboard the legendary Yellow Water Billabong, where the thrill-seekers can search for elusive saltwater crocodiles while observing the mesmerizing array of birdlife. Witness the abundance of wildlife in both aquatic and terrestrial environments, creating a spectacle unlike any other.

Following lunch, venture further into the park's heartland, traversing the Adelaide River and Marrakai Plains. Upon reaching Nourlangie Rock, embark on a guided walk led by your expert local guide. Here, you'll have the chance to admire the profound Aboriginal rock art, a testament to humanity's enduring connection to these lands.

This tour promises a comprehensive experience, allowing you to witness the ever-changing beauty of Kakadu National Park, from its varied ecosystems to its rich cultural history.
